Golf Course Superintendent & General Manager
White Plains Golf Course
Application
Details
Posted: 07-Jul-25
Location: Cookeville, Tennessee
Type: Full Time
Salary: $75,000-$90,000

We are seeking a dedicated and experienced Golf Course Superintendent to oversee the maintenance and management of our golf course, as well as fulfill General Manager duties within the pro shop.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in golf course management and will be responsible for supervising the Assistant Manager, who will oversee pro shop operations. This role requires expertise in turf management, irrigation systems, mechanical operations, and staff management.
Key Responsibilities:
Oversee all aspects of golf course maintenance, ensuring the highest quality of turf and landscaping.
Supervise the Assistant Manager, who will manage pro shop operations and staff.
Manage hiring, training, and scheduling of all course and pro shop personnel to ensure efficient operation.
Handle payroll and light accounting tasks related to course operations and pro shop.
Develop and manage the annual budget for both golf course maintenance and pro shop operations.
Maintain and repair irrigation systems and golf course machinery.
Collaborate with the pro shop team to enhance the overall customer experience and service quality.
Ensure compliance with safety and environmental regulations.
Monitor and evaluate course conditions, making adjustments as needed.
Qualifications:
Minimum of 3 years of experience in an assistant superintendent or full superintendent role.
Strong knowledge of turf management, irrigation systems, and mechanical operations.
Experience with payroll, budgeting, and employee staffing.
Excellent leadership and communication skills, with the ability to manage and motivate a team.
Ability to work flexible hours, including weekends and holidays as needed.
A degree in turf management, agronomy, or a related field is preferred but not required.
White Plains Golf Course has been in business since May 1988. This 18 hole course has a great layout, offering many challenges for the experienced golfer and some easy par three’s for the new golfer. The course is settled in the valley surrounded by mountains so the landscape is a beautiful attraction.White Plains Golf Course is a public course that offers memberships for the golfer that plays often!
